#168682 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#168682 is composed of 8.6% red, 52.5%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 3%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 177.9 degrees, a saturation of 71.8% and a lightness of 30.6%. #168682 color hex could be obtained by blending #2cffff with #000d05.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

#168682 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#168682 has RGB values of R:22, G:134,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.03,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 1476226.
